Anda di halaman 1dari 2

1.

basis data adalah kumpulan informadi yang disimpan di dalam komputer secara sistematik
sehingga dapat diperiksa menggunakan suatu program komputer untuk memperoleh informasi dari
basis data tersebut.
2. DBMS adalah suatu sistem atau software yang dirancang khusus untuk mengelola suatu database
dan menjalankan operasi terhadap data yang diminta oleh banyak pengguna. DBMS adalah
singkatan dari “Database Management System” yaitu sistem penorganisasian dan sistem pengolahan
Database pada komputer.
3. Kelebihan DBMS
 Bisa mengendalikan pengulangan data.
 Memberikan data yang konsisten.
 Memiliki kemampuan dalam mendapat informasi yang lebih banyak, dan jumlah data yang
sama.
 Pengguna bisa menggunakan data bersama-sama.
 Dapat memperbaiki integritas data.
Kekurangan DBMS
 Penggunaannya cukup kompleks.
 Kompleksitas yang dimiliki DBMS mengakibatkan ukurannya yang besar.
 Biayanya tidak tergantung pada lingkungan dan juga fungsi yang disediakan.
 Terdapat biaya tambahan untuk hardware.
 Dibutuhkan biaya konversi dalam penggunaan DBMS yang baru.
 Pada umumnya performa kinerjanya menurun seiring waktu.
 Performa yang menurun akan mengakibatkan ke gagalan yang lebih besar.
4. Sebutkan dan jelaskan beberapa contoh DBMS ?
 MySQL
Adalah salah satu aplikasi yang termasuk vendor DBMS yang merupakan salah satu aplikasi
umum dan paling banyak digunakan oleh pengguna data maupun para programmer. Salah
satu alasan mengapa MySQL banyak digunakan karena aplikasi ini terkenal sebagai open
source atau gratis.

 PostgreSQL
Salah satu alasan mengapa banyak yang menggunakan PostgreSQL adalah karena fiturnya
yang tersedia dalam jumlah yang banyak sehingga akan memudahkan pengguna atau
programmer.

 Microsoft SQL Server


Microsoft SQL Server memiliki kemampuan dimana ia bisa beroperasi dengan baik di 64
maupun 32 bit.

 Microsoft Acces
Aplikasi yang satu ini juga merupakan aplikasi buatan Microsoft yang biasanya digunakan
oleh kalangan rumahan maupun juga perusahaan kecil sampai dengan menengah.

5. Query Processor adalah Komponen yang berfungsi menterjemahkan perintah dalam bahasa query
ke instruksi low-level yang dapat dimengerti database manager.
6. Basis data terbagi menjadi 2 yaitu:
1. Berbasis objek (perancangan basis data hanya sebatas symbol)
2. Berbasis Record (perancangan basis data berdasarkan tabel)
7. Sebutkan dan jelaskan aplikasi / software DBMS ?
 MySQL
Adalah salah satu aplikasi yang termasuk vendor DBMS yang merupakan salah satu aplikasi
umum dan paling banyak digunakan oleh pengguna data maupun para programmer. Salah
satu alasan mengapa MySQL banyak digunakan karena aplikasi ini terkenal sebagai open
source atau gratis.

 PostgreSQL
Salah satu alasan mengapa banyak yang menggunakan PostgreSQL adalah karena fiturnya
yang tersedia dalam jumlah yang banyak sehingga akan memudahkan pengguna atau
programmer.

 Microsoft SQL Server


Microsoft SQL Server memiliki kemampuan dimana ia bisa beroperasi dengan baik di 64
maupun 32 bit.

 Microsoft Acces
Aplikasi yang satu ini juga merupakan aplikasi buatan Microsoft yang biasanya digunakan
oleh kalangan rumahan maupun juga perusahaan kecil sampai dengan menengah.

8.Sebutkan dan jelaskan aplikasi / software non DBMS ?


CouchDB, Cassandra, Redis, Riak, Neo4J, OrientDB
9. Aturan penamaan database :
 Gunakan huruf kecil dan jangan pernah pakai spasi.
 Gunakan kata benda atau nama proyek tambahkan db dibelakang, contoh kampusdb.
 Jika database terdiri dari dua suku kata gunakan garis bawah, contoh transaksi_detail.
 Jangan gunakan kata tercadang seperti “select, create, insert ” dsb.
Aturan membuat tabel :
Tabel dalam database tidak boleh mengandung record (data) ganda, atau dengan kata lain tidak
boleh ada redudancy data. Jika terdapat Tabel dalam database tidak boleh mengandung record
(data) ganda, atau dengan kata lain tidak boleh ada redudancy data. Jika terdapat data yang
sama, maka perlu dilihat kembali rancangan tabelnya. Setiap tabel dalam database, harus
memiliki field (kolom) yang unik sebagai primary key yang sama, maka perlu dilihat kembali
rancangan tabelnya. Setiap tabel dalam database, harus memiliki field (kolom) yang unik sebagai
primary key.
10. Pada RDBMS data yang disimpan pada sebuah tabel dapat dihubungkan dengan tabel yang lain.
Sedangkan pada DBMS data yang tersimpan tidak dapat dihubungkan ke tabel lain

Anda mungkin juga menyukai